San Francisco sees surge in electric scooter injuries over July 4 weekend
From the article
SAN FRANCISCO (KRON) -- First responders in San Francisco say there was a slight uptick in calls for service this Fourth of July, and while there were several serious injuries related to illegal fireworks, the biggest increases were in electric scooter injuries. “I do know that we saw in about a 40-minute period, 15 different victims [...]
